Khaled Moussawi, MD, PhD

Assoc Professor in Residence
Departments of Neurology and Psychiatry

The Translational Neuropsychiatry Through Neuromodulaton (TN²) laboratory investigates the neurobiology of substance use disorders and uses neuromodulation tools such as Low-Intensity Focused Ultrasound (LIFU), Transcranial Magnetic Stimulation (TMS), and Deep Brain Stimulation (DBS) to treat drug and alcohol addiction and related neuropsychiatric disorders. The goal of the lab is to identify neural biomarkers of craving and drug-seeking behaviors and leverage those findings to develop individualized clinical treatments with neuromodulation.
